- What is the best time to visit Baglamukhi Mata Temple?
The temple can be visited at any time of the year as devotees are welcomed throughout. However, it is best to visit the temple during Navratri and the monsoons.
- What is the distance between Delhi and Baglamukhi Mata Temple?
The Baglamukhi Mata Temple is at an approximate distance of 470 kms from Delhi which when covered directly by road can make up for a drive of almost 9-10 hours.

- Why is Baglamukhi Mata Temple so popular among devotees?
The temple is so popular because the goddess is believed to protect devotees from all sorts of evil, enemies, negative energies, black magic or any kind of obstacles in life.
- Is an entry fee required to visit Baglamukhi Mata Temple?
No entry fee as such is required to visit the temple. Anyone can seek blessings without getting charged, however, the temple is open to any kind of donations for its maintenance and for carrying out various festivities.
- What are the timings of Baglamukhi Mata Temple?
The temple remains open from early morning 5 am to around 7-9 pm in the evening. However, inquiring from the locals before heading to the temple would be a great idea.

- Which other places can one visit around Baglamukhi Mata Temple?
Along with visiting the Baglamukhi Mata Temple, one can visit other temples like Chamunda Devi temple, Baijnath temple and Jwala Devi temple. Places like Palampur and Dharamshala can be explored too.
